Why Concrete is at the Center of the Green Building Revolution



Concrete has actually long been the foundation-- essentially-- of building. From bridges and sidewalks to homes and skyscrapers, it's everywhere. Yet conventional concrete manufacturing is resource-intensive and responsible for a substantial amount of international carbon emissions. As recognition grows and guidelines change, the market is under pressure to introduce.



This is where environmentally friendly concrete can be found in. It isn't about transforming concrete totally, but instead boosting it. Contractors, designers, and developers are finding means to make it more effective, much less hazardous to the atmosphere, and much more visually appealing.



What Makes Concrete Eco-Friendly?



Green concrete is developed to minimize its carbon impact while still executing like traditional mixes. Some methods use recycled materials such as crushed glass or slag from industrial waste. Others incorporate carbon capture techniques, reducing discharges during production. There are even concrete types that can absorb contamination from the air, assisting to clean urban environments.



But sustainability doesn't quit with active ingredients. It additionally consists of longevity. Eco-friendly mixes often last longer and resist weathering, which means less repair services and replacements down the line. That makes them not just an eco-friendly option, but a clever financial investment.

The Role of Local Sourcing and Waste Reduction



In the past, building typically depended on materials delivered over fars away, boosting discharges and expenses. With eco-friendly concrete, many of the raw products can be sourced recommended reading locally, reducing transport impacts. In addition, utilizing commercial by-products like fly ash or recycled aggregates assists divert waste from land fills and gives new life to what would or else be discarded.



It's a round approach to structure-- utilizing what we already have in smarter means, saving sources, and creating resilient structures that serve their areas well.
